Jatra is a form of Indian folk theater. It belongs to which state of India?

  1. Madhya Pradesh

  2. Gujarat

  3. Bengal

  4. Karnataka

  5. Kerala

Reveal answer Fill a bubble to check yourself
C Correct answer
Explanation

Jatra is a folk drama form originated in the Bhakti movement in Bengal.
